Quick answer: The average cost to ship a car 1,370 miles from Cape Coral, Florida, to Grand Rapids, Michigan, ranges from $995 to $1,457. Costs vary depending on factors like the type of vehicle, transport method, and time of year. For a more detailed quote, use our car shipping cost calculator.

How we chose the best car shipping companies
We analyzed 2,400 car shipping companies nationally and evaluated and rated them based on key factors using our unique system of methodology.
Here’s what we considered:
- Standard services: We looked at the types and variety of services each company provides. This includes whether they offer open transport, enclosed transport, or both. We also rated companies based on whether they have door-to-door shipping or just terminal pickup and delivery and the kinds of vehicles they ship. Companies that move RVs, motorcycles, and other specialty vehicles scored higher than those that just ship cars.
- Add-on services: We gave additional points to companies that provide special optional services like expedited shipping, guaranteed pickup times, car washes, and rental car reimbursement.
- Customer satisfaction: We analyzed consumer reviews on multiple major platforms, such as Yelp, Google, and Trustpilot to see whether a car shipping company delivers services promptly with good communication and within the estimated cost. We also evaluated each company’s standing within the car shipping industry as a whole by confirming U.S. Department of Transportation (USDOT) licensure and checked their membership in — and reputation with — trade associations.
- Availability: We awarded points to each company based on their service areas. Companies that are available in Alaska and Hawaii, in addition to the continental U.S., scored higher than those that just service the Lower 48 or fewer states.
- Scheduling and payment: We reviewed the ease with which customers can schedule services and estimate their costs through accurate quotes, price matching, flat-rate pricing, and other perks. Car shippers that give binding quotes or a price-lock promise got more positive rankings than those that are not as transparent with pricing.
Car shipping alternatives from FL to MI
If you’re planning a move from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ids, you’ll need to decide how to transport your vehicle. We’ve outlined the main car shipping options you can choose from and what to expect from each.
Coordinate with your movers
If you’re moving from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ids, many of the best interstate movers work with trusted car shipping companies. They can coordinate your vehicle transport as part of the full-service moving package, but you’ll be limited to their chosen provider and pricing.
Drive your car
Choosing whether to drive or ship your vehicle involves trade-offs. The 1,370 miles from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ids might make for an enjoyable road trip and save you money. But the downsides include added wear on your car and potential risks from weather or long-distance driving.
Use a driving service
Hiring someone else to drive your car directly from Florida to Michigan is an option, albeit an expensive one. And you’ll need to find a driver you trust to safely get your car from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ids. Plus, you’ll still be putting extra miles on your car regardless of who drives it there.
Ship your car via train
Transporting your car by train is one of the safest and most affordable options for getting your vehicle to Grand Rapids—especially if your household goods are already moving by rail. In fact, it’s the cheapest car shipping method available. The downside is limited pickup and drop-off flexibility, plus longer transit times compared to standard car shipping or driving yourself.
Factors affecting Cape Coral to Grand Rapids car shipping costs
When transporting your vehicle from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ids, these factors will influence the cost:
Transport method
When shipping your car from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ids, you can choose between open, enclosed, or top-loaded transport. The right option depends on your budget and vehicle type.
Open carriers from Cape Coral are generally the most affordable, while enclosed transport offers extra protection for high-end or classic vehicles. Not sure which is best for your move to Grand Rapids? Check out our guide on open vs. enclosed shipping.
Vehicle size and type
The kind of car you’re shipping out of Cape Coral has a major impact on cost. Bigger vehicles require more room and increase the carrier’s load, which drives the price up. That’s why transporting a large SUV to Grand Rapids will cost more than moving a smaller car.
Distance and route
To put it simply, the longer the journey, the higher the price. Distance impacts pricing in terms of fuel and labor expenses, as well as added costs like toll fees and carrier maintenance. Shipping your car 1,370 miles from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ids will likely be more expensive than transporting it a shorter distance within Florida.
Where you’re shipping your car matters, too. Rates are usually lower for routes along major highways and higher for more remote areas.
The time of the year
Both seasonal trends and local weather in Cape Coral and Grand Rapids can influence what you’ll pay for car shipping.
Cape Coral averages 355 days of sunshine each year, but experiences precipitation on 145 days per year. While the summers are very warm, humid, and rainy, the winters in Cape Coral are dry with moderate temperatures.
August, July and June are the most most advisable months to move in Grand Rapids, while January and December are the least comfortable months.
High-demand periods such as summer and the winter holidays often drive up prices. If you plan to ship your car from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ids during these busy times, expect higher costs due to increased demand.
Fuel prices
Fluctuating fuel prices are one of the biggest elements affecting car shipping costs. On the 1,370-mile drive between Cape Coral and Grand Rapids, even small changes at the pump can make a difference. When fuel rates rise, so do shipping charges.
Delivery expectations
By allowing more flexibility with your delivery window, you could secure discounted rates from your shipper. The process of moving a car from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ids usually takes three–eight days. Flexible timing helps keep costs down, while expedited shipping shortens the wait for an extra fee.
Comparing Cape Coral and Grand Rapids vehicle regulations
Parking permits
- Cape Coral: Effective October 29, 2021, carriers may purchase Florida trip permits online through the FLHSMV Commercial Vehicle Permit Portal. A Florida Temporary Trip Permit is valid for ten (10) days and costs $30.00. Carriers may also contact the Bureau of Commercial Vehicle and Driver Services at (850) 617-3711 weekdays from 8-4:30 to obtain a trip permit.
- Grand Rapids: The City requires that you apply for a Temporary Occupancy Permit. With this permit you will gain permission to temporarily close the needed area of the right-of-way. Be sure to clarify any questions with the City Government by contacting them ahead of time at 311 or 616-456-3000 or [email protected].
Car insurance requirements
- Cape Coral: All vehicles registered in Florida must have PIP and PDL insurance coverage at the time of registration with a minimum of $10,000 for PIP and $10,000 for PDL.
- Grand Rapids: Michigan requires a minimum auto insurance coverage of $50,000/$100,000 for bodily injury and $10,000 for property damage in case of an accident.
Vehicle inspections
- Cape Coral: Unlike many states, Florida does not mandate vehicle owners to undergo regular emission or safety inspections for their vehicles.
- Grand Rapids: Michigan does not require vehicle inspections for registration purposes. There is no state mandate for car safety inspections or emissions testing.
Driver’s license
- Cape Coral: If you possess a valid driver's license from another state, you are legally permitted to drive in Florida without obtaining a Florida driver's license. However, if you choose to obtain one, you only need to pass a vision and hearing test, no written or road test is necessary.
- Grand Rapids: Michigan law requires new residents to promptly title and register their vehicles, with no grace period provided. A person is considered a resident if they live in the state and prove their legal presence in the US. To comply with these requirements, new residents should visit a Secretary of State office to obtain a Michigan driver's license, title, and registration as soon as they establish residency.
FAQ
How much does it cost to ship a car from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ids?
The cost to ship a car from Cape Coral, FL to Grand Rapids, MI varies based on several factors, including the type of transport (open vs. enclosed car shipping), vehicle size and weight, and the current fuel prices. On average, transporting your vehicle from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ids will range from $995 to $1,457.
How long will it take to ship my car from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ids?
It will take approximately three to eight days to ship your car the 1,370 miles from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ids. If you need it quicker, ask your shipper about expedited delivery.
What’s the cheapest way to ship my car from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ids?
An open-transport car carrier is the cheapest way to ship your car from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ids. However, there are other methods. Read our post on the cheapest way to ship a car to learn more.
Is it cheaper to ship my car or drive it from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ids?
It is generally cheaper to drive your car from Cape Coral to Grand Rapids than to ship it. However, when deciding whether to drive your car or ship it, you need to factor in related costs like maintenance fees that could result from the additional wear-and-tear on your vehicle during the 1,370-mile trip. Long-distance trips also involve food and possibly lodging, which can add up quickly.
